Heetkamp
Heetkamp in Holland makes a variety of restraints with the aim of preventing self harm
and undressing. All items are all available in a range of sizes to cover females
and males, youth to full adult. Bespoke options are encouraged at extra cost.
Many of the restraints mirror those made by Segufix in design although
changes are evident e.g. the method of cuff padding.
Heetkamp have two designs of button lock to prevent unauthorised removal of
the restraints. Both consist of a pin to pass through eyeleted  strapping and a
button head. The first and oldest design uses a two pronged key inserted into
the top of the button to unlock it and three pin lengths are available to accommodate
different thickness of strapping. A magnetic button lock using a similar
pin system is also available. This latter item uses a sideways application of
the magnetic key against the button to unlock it.
   Heetkamp offer a coverall with a list of options including closed arms and
legs, front or rear zip both of which can be made locking to prevent undressing,
hiding of contraband or interference with sanitary protection.
A sleep sack is available. The patient is secured within the sack by a
waist strap and locking full length front zip. If required further restriction
can be applied by using wrist cuffs fitted to the two loops either side of the
waist strap.
To prevent a patient getting out of bed an interesting open bed restraint
jacket is available with a locking crotch strap to prevent the occupant
wriggling out.
 Arm corsets are unique
as far as I know to Heetkamp. Made of leather and laced their full
length they are designed to impede the wearer by
totally stopping both arms from bending at the elbow. Worn under a jumpsuit, for example they
are a discreet and very disabling restraint which if applied correctly can not be removed
unaided by the patient.  
Anti-rip Smock. Used where modesty is required and where ripping of clothing
is a problem.
Heetkamp also make a straight jacket of an unusual build there are no under arm or
 chest
loops as standard to prevent the patient from lifting his or her arms over their
head. There is no arm strap only loops at the sleeve ends. However with a little
imagination a central pass thro strap can be attached and the arm loops can also
likewise be secured. The main body of the garment locks on and the crotch strap
is also lockable. A short sleeved jacket and a version without a crotch strap
are available.   
The traditional full bed restraint set built to a very similar design and
efficiency to that of Segufix. With the the full set as shown here 7 point
fixing is achieved.
